AI Insight: XWEL Financial Trends
XWELL remains unprofitable with deteriorating equity position; Q1 2026 net loss widened to $11M despite flat revenue.
• Revenue flat at $7M for four consecutive quarters (Q1 2025–Q1 2026), signaling stalled growth in core business.
• Net losses persist across full period; Q1 2026 net loss of $11M is worst result in dataset despite operating income improving to $-5M.
• Operating cash outflow averaged $2.6M per quarter; Q1 2026 at $-5M reflects ongoing cash burn with no clear path to positive conversion.
⚠ Equity swung from $9M (Q2 2024) to $0M (Q1 2026); negative equity through Q4 2025 indicates accumulated losses eroding shareholder position.
⚠ Operating income improved from $-9M (Q4 2025) to $-5M (Q1 2026), but net loss widened $2M quarter-over-quarter—non-operating charges deteriorating.
AI Insight: XWEL Ratio Trends
XWEL remains deeply unprofitable across all metrics, with operating margin deteriorating sharply to −81.6% in Q1 2026 after a brief improvement through Q3 2025.
• Operating margin worsened from −10.5% in Q3 2025 to −81.6% in Q1 2026; NPM collapsed to −168.8%, indicating severe cost control breakdown.
• ROA deteriorated from −13.3% in Q3 2025 to implied deeply negative in Q1 2026 TTM; asset efficiency remains critically impaired.
• Q3 2025 marked the only quarter approaching breakeven (−10.5% OpMargin), but Q4 2025 and Q1 2026 show violent reversal to triple-digit losses.
⚠ Sharp quarterly swings (Q3 2025 at −10.5% vs Q4 2025 at −126.5%) suggest underlying instability—investigate one-time charges or seasonal distortion.
⚠ TTM operating margin now −62.2%, implying cumulative four-quarter loss; path to profitability remains opaque absent operational restructuring.

Which hedge funds own XWEL?
Institutional investors are required to disclose their holdings quarterly via SEC Form 13F. 13F Pro aggregates these filings to show which hedge funds, mutual funds, and asset managers are buying or selling XWEL.
